
This platform represents a sophisticated combination of chance control and tactical approach. Unlike classic rotating wheels, the platform operates on a tile-based framework where users choose squares to uncover either prizes or mines. Every pick significantly increases potential rewards, creating a dynamic balance between ambition and caution that shapes the participant experience.
The fundamental concept driving this architecture focuses on user independence. You manage when to cash out, which squares to uncover, and eventually determine your individual risk limit. Such level of control differentiates this game from fixed result experiences and places tactical planning at the core of all round. This platform operates on a demonstrably fair method that can be confirmed via encrypted hashing functions. This transparency places this game distinctly in the industry, allowing participants to confirm the predetermined conclusion of each game ahead of cells getting revealed. This Random Numeric Engine (RNG) this game uses was verified by Gaming Testing Global (Gaming Labs International), meeting the Gaming Labs 19 standard for game systems—a validated reality that emphasizes this commitment to honesty.
The RTP to Player (return) percentage varies based on user decisions rather than being fixed. Safe approaches generate minimal fluctuation with percentages nearing 99%, whereas bold approaches bring elevated variance. That variable return model signifies one’s playing style immediately affects the mathematical advantage, generating individualized sessions specific to every session.
Effective participation with the system requires grasping fluctuation and capital control. We recommend the segmented approach: divide one’s bankroll into portions and bet merely preset portions per round. This methodology shields from the inevitable variance shifts built-in to our platform structure.
Trend recognition constitutes a common misconception among players. Our RNG guarantees full autonomy among games, meaning previous outcomes offer no predictive worth for subsequent results. That gambler’s error—believing previous events impact future likelihoods in separate trials—continues the most typical strategic misstep we observe.

Our demonstrably transparent framework produces a back-end key, user key, and counter for individual round. Such three components unite through cryptographic algorithm to produce verifiable outcomes that neither platform and not player can change post-commitment. Such secure method constitutes the highest standard in transparent game mechanisms.

This emotional component remains vital to long-term success with this game. The sunk cost fallacy—continuing to choose tiles since you’ve already invested in this game—represents a common pitfall. We encourage participants to assess individual decision independently, considering previously-revealed squares as unimportant to whether the subsequent selection constitutes positive expected value.
